Output 209d0c35284b8e38e7f6f659065c70e3708a9276f6e90faf1b5b2ad4bed635d4:8

value
673868
script pubkey
OP_0 OP_PUSHBYTES_20 521abb2a2a679b1a54c894355ee795852b8632c9
address
bc1q2gdtk232v7d354xgjs64aeu4s54cvvkfhsxhmy
transaction
209d0c35284b8e38e7f6f659065c70e3708a9276f6e90faf1b5b2ad4bed635d4
spent
true